How the Sensor System Creates the Closing Condition in Lacon

The safety sensor system consists of a transmitter and a receiver mounted at the bottom of the door opening on each side in Lacon, IL. The transmitter sends a continuous infrared beam to the receiver in Lacon. When the receiver detects the full beam, it sends a continuous confirmation signal to the opener's logic board indicating a clear path in Lacon, IL. The logic board will complete the closing cycle only while this confirmation signal is continuously present in Lacon. Any interruption of the signal causes the logic board to reverse the door immediately in Lacon, IL.

The Four LED States and What Each One Means in Lacon, IL

There are four possible LED states across the two sensors that EZ Open reads on arrival in Lacon. Both LEDs solid indicates correct sensor alignment and function in Lacon, IL. Receiver LED blinking, transmitter LED solid indicates sensor misalignment or a beam obstruction in Lacon. Receiver LED off, transmitter LED solid indicates no power to the receiver, which points to a wiring fault or receiver failure in Lacon, IL. Both LEDs off indicates no power to either sensor, which points to the sensor wiring connection at the opener control board in Lacon.

Misalignment vs Component Failure — How to Tell the Difference in Lacon

A blinking receiver LED indicates the receiver isn't detecting the full beam from the transmitter in Lacon, IL. This can mean the sensor bracket has rotated out of the correct alignment or the sensor component itself has failed in Lacon. To distinguish between the two, EZ Open gently adjusts the receiver bracket through its full range of angles while watching the LED in Lacon, IL. If the LED becomes solid at any angle, the sensor is functional but misaligned in Lacon. If the LED stays blinking through the full range of bracket adjustment, the sensor itself has failed and requires replacement in Lacon, IL.

Why Sunlight Can Produce the Exact Same Symptom as a Failed Sensor in Lacon, IL

Direct sunlight contains infrared radiation at intensities that can overwhelm the receiver's ability to distinguish the transmitter's signal from the background in Lacon. When direct sunlight hits the receiver lens at a specific angle, the receiver can't confirm the transmitter's beam against the solar infrared background in Lacon, IL. The opener reverses the door exactly as it would for a misaligned sensor or a physical obstruction in Lacon. A door that won't close only at specific times of day when the sun is at a particular angle is almost certainly experiencing solar interference in Lacon, IL.

Down-Travel Limit Set Too High in Lacon

The down-travel limit setting tells the opener when to stop the closing cycle in Lacon, IL. A limit set too high stops the opener before the door reaches the floor in Lacon. The door stops short of the floor without reversing in Lacon, IL. This is often confused with a sensor fault but produces a distinctly different symptom, the door stops rather than reverses in Lacon. A limit calibration adjustment resolves this cause immediately in Lacon, IL.

Spring Imbalance Triggering Force Limit in Lacon, IL

A spring that has lost significant tension produces a heavier door in Lacon. The heavier door requires more closing force from the opener in Lacon, IL. If the required closing force exceeds the opener's force limit setting, the opener stops before the door reaches the floor in Lacon. This produces a door that stops short without reversing in Lacon, IL. Spring assessment and replacement where indicated alongside force limit recalibration addresses this cause in Lacon.

Damaged Wiring Between Sensor and Opener in Lacon, IL

The low-voltage wiring connecting each sensor to the opener control board runs from the sensor bracket up the door frame and along the ceiling to the opener in Lacon. Damage at any point along this run, from a staple that pierced the wire, a rodent that chewed through it, or physical disturbance that cut or kinked it, can produce sensor symptoms that appear identical to sensor failure or misalignment in Lacon, IL. EZ Open inspects the complete wiring run where sensor LED behavior doesn't clearly indicate misalignment or component failure in Lacon.
